Output 43d37cf4f8be652fa92e0905ad342f9b0d2e9235ac6ac3665ce4e4e10e2000b4:0

value
617802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d832fea774bebed85a1ff7658bf6e7f27c26480 OP_EQUAL
address
3G3sAhst9JPNCtdmZHQyPQpUzLYMc2T4Sq
transaction
43d37cf4f8be652fa92e0905ad342f9b0d2e9235ac6ac3665ce4e4e10e2000b4
confirmations
22014
spent
true